About Coursera

Coursera was founded in 2012 by Stanford professors Andrew Ng and Daphne Koller to make world-class learning accessible to everyone, everywhere. Today, over 190 million learners and 375+ university and industry partners use our platform to gain skills in fields like AI, data science, technology, and business. As a Delaware public benefit corporation and Certified B Corp, we’re driven by the belief that learning can transform lives through learning.

Job Overview

We are seeking a dynamic and results-driven Sr. Manager, Content Maintenance and Optimization to lead a multidisciplinary team responsible for maintaining and optimizing the content of our courses. This team, comprising instructional designers, quality assurance specialists, and data system/ business analyst, is crucial to ensuring the sustained quality and relevance of our educational offerings.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age and supervise the offshore team, including instructional designers, quality assurance specialists, and data/systems analysts.
  • Work with leadership to ensure that SMART goals for the optimization team are met. Find / drive solutions that will help the team and hence the organization in meeting goals
  • Monitor team performance, providing regular feedback and coaching to ensure high-quality output.
  • Build strong relationships with key Coursera stakeholders (e.g. Partner Success, Partner Implementation, Design, etc.) and thereby manage/lead Optimization related threads
  • Report metrics and project updates to internal stakeholders regularly.
  • Collect feedback from internal stakeholders and translate it into actionable tasks for the team.
  • Develop and maintain project plans, schedules, and documentation. Lead initiatives that will aid in content maintenance and optimization
  • Ensure that all course revisions and updates align with organizational standards and objectives.
  • Resolve conflicts and challenges within the team, fostering a collaborative and productive work environment.

Basic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Education, Project Management, Business Administration, or a related field.
  • 12+ years of experience in a team leadership or project management role, preferably within the e-learning industry.
  • Strong understanding of instructional design principles and practices.
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work across time zones and manage remote teams effectively.
